The Kradia Isle was a small, heart-shaped island between Samos and Kos in the Southern Sporades, Greece.
During the Peloponnesian War the misthios Kassandra visited the isle, finding the remains of a couple.[1]
Trivia[edit | edit source]
- The word κραδιά (kradia) is a poetic variant of the Greek word κᾰρδῐ́ᾱ (kardíā), which means 'heart'.
